Fairfield home prices fall in June 2017

Re 1

The median sale price of a home sold in June 2017 in Fairfield fell by $9,332 while total sales increased by 20%, according to BlockShopper.com.

In June 2017, there were 78 homes sold, with a median sale price of $132,750 - a 6.6% decrease over the $142,082 median sale price for the same period of the previous year. There were 65 homes sold in Fairfield in June 2016.
